Forsythoside H
Forsythoside H is a nartural product from Forsythia suspense (Thunb.) Vahl.

Providing storage is as stated on the product vial and the vial is kept tightly sealed, the product can be stored for up to
24 months(2-8C).
Wherever possible, you should prepare and use solutions on the same day. However, if you need to make up stock solutions in advance, we recommend that you store the solution as aliquots in tightly sealed vials at -20C. Generally, these will be useable for up to two weeks. Before use, and prior to opening the vial we recommend that you allow your product to equilibrate to room temperature for at least 1 hour.

Molecules. 2009 Mar 25;14(3):1324-31.
New phenylethanoid glycosides from the fruits of forsythia suspense (thunb.) vahl.[Pubmed:
19325526 ]
METHODS AND RESULTS:
Forsythoside H, Forsythoside I, Forsythoside J (1-3), three new caffeoyl phenylethanoid glycosides (CPGs), were isolated from the fruits of Forsythia suspense (Thunb.) Vahl., together with six known phenylethanoid glycosides: Forsythoside A (4), Forsythoside F (5), Forsythoside E (6), 2-(3,4-dihydroxyphenyl)ethyl-beta-D-glucopyranoside (7), phenethyl alcohol beta-D-xylo-pyranosyl-(1-->6)-beta-D-glucopyranoside (8) and calceolarioside B (9).
CONCLUSIONS:
Their structures were determined by spectroscopic and chemical methods.
